+ <h3 id="dns">
+ <a href="#dns">How do I use a custom DNS server?</a>
+ </h3>
+
+ <p>It isn't possible to directly override the DNS servers provided by the network via
+ DHCP. Instead, use the Private DNS feature in Settings ➔ Network &amp; internet ➔
+ Advanced ➔ Private DNS to set the hostname of a DNS-over-TLS server. It needs to have
+ a valid certificate such as a free certificate from Let's Encrypt. The OS will look up
+ the Private DNS hostname via the network provided DNS servers and will then force all
+ other DNS requests through the Private DNS server. Unlike an option to override the
+ network-provided DNS servers, this prevents the network from monitoring or tampering
+ with DNS requests/responses.</p>
+
+ <p>Configuring a static IP address for a network requires entering DNS servers
+ manually, but you should still use the Private DNS feature with it, and you shouldn't
+ misuse the static IP address option just to override the DNS servers.</p>
+
+ <p>VPN service apps can also provide their own DNS implementation and/or servers,
+ including an alternate implementation of encrypted DNS. Private DNS takes precedence
+ over VPN-provided DNS and using Private DNS is still recommended with a VPN.</p>
